    waters of the Weddell Sea, reveal a steady CO 2 increase of anthropogenic origin, as surface water charged with anthropogenic CO 2 is a major component in the formation of WSBW (Van Heuven et al. 2011). The findings reflect the deep-sea sequestration of anthropogenic CO 2 , thus contributing to diminishing the burden of excess CO 2 in the atmosphere. The largest increase of CO 2 is found in [...] (Van Heuven et al. 2014). Here, uptake of excess CO 2 , i.e. anthropogenic CO 2 , from the atmosphere has obviously occurred.
